Sean ‘Diddy’ Combs Pleads Not Guilty to Sex Trafficking Charges
Sean ‘Diddy’ Combs, the renowned music mogul and entrepreneur, appeared in federal court in New York City on Friday to face the latest version of an indictment accusing him of sex trafficking crimes spanning over two decades. The 55-year-old entertainer, whose beard appeared noticeably grayer compared to recent public appearances, stood before Judge Arun Subramanian with his hands folded. He acknowledged that he had read and understood the charges against him. Combs, who has been held without bail since his arrest in September, displayed a mix of defiance and emotion during the proceedings. Upon entering the courtroom, he hugged two of his lawyers and exchanged affectionate gestures with family members in attendance. As he was escorted out by U.S. marshals following the hearing, he blew kisses and waved to his loved ones.
The court also addressed the next steps in the case. Judge Subramanian revealed that questionnaires will be distributed to hundreds of potential jurors by the end of April, with jury selection set to begin on May 5. Opening statements are expected to commence on May 12. The Allegations Against Combs
The indictment against Sean Combs paints a disturbing picture of a powerful figure allegedly using his influence to manipulate and control women. Prosecutors allege that Combs exploited his status as a music mogul to intimidate, threaten, and lure women into his orbit under the guise of romantic relationships. Once these women were in his circle, the indictment claims, he used force, threats, and coercion to force them into commercial sex acts. The charges detail a pattern of abuse that includes violence, verbal abuse, and threats of financial and reputational harm.
The indictment specifically highlights the experiences of three women, but it suggests that there may be more victims. It describes incidents in which Combs allegedly engaged in violent behavior, including throwing objects, hitting, dragging, choking, and shoving individuals. One particularly alarming allegation claims that Combs dangled a victim over an apartment balcony. Defense Challenges the Charges
Combs’ defense team has pushed back against the allegations, arguing that the charges are an attempt to demonize consensual sexual relationships between adults. A key point of contention in the case is a video that aired on CNN last year, which appears to show Combs physically assaulting his former protege and girlfriend, R&B singer Cassie, in a hotel hallway. The video captures Combs punching Cassie and throwing her to the floor.
Prosecutors argue that the video is “critical to the case,” as it provides direct evidence of Combs’ alleged propensity for violence. However, Combs’ defense attorney, Marc Agnifilo, has dismissed the video as misleading and manipulated. He claims that certain parts of the footage were sped up by as much as 50% and that other segments were taken out of context. Agnifilo asserted that the video is “deceptive” and does not accurately represent the events that unfolded. Concerns Over Victim Privacy and Safety
Another significant issue raised during the hearing was the handling of information related to the alleged victims. Assistant U.S. Attorney Mitzi Steiner revealed that many of the individuals who may testify against Combs are “incredibly frightened” about their identities being revealed publicly or shared with the defense team. She emphasized that the government is reluctant to disclose details about the accusers until legally required to do so.
